QUALIFICATIONS:
A valid Michigan teaching certificate and an Early Childhood Education (ZA) or Early Childhood-General and Special Education (ZS) endorsement
OR A bachelor’s degree in early childhood education
OR child development with a specialization in preschool teaching.
The transcript will document a major, rather than a minor, in child development or early childhood education
Experience working with Preschool Children preferred

RESPONSIBILITIES:
Helps to plan varied activities for preschool children using the Connect4Learning (C4L) Curriculum
Participates in home visitation with all enrolled families twice a year
Participates in Parent/Teacher Conferences twice a year
Participates in Parent Involvement Nights twice a year
Follows consistent routines and limits
Makes all children feel comfortable, secure and loved Insures health and safety of children at all times
Helps to provide regular feedback to parents about their children
Helps to maintain a portfolio on each child using the Teaching Strategies Gold
Assists families with resource referrals
Enforces the discipline policies and procedures stated in the parent handbook and staff handbook
Maintains classroom orderliness
Works with the Director of Early Childhood Programs to plan field trips and special activities
Attends Early Childhood Curriculum meetings
Helps to plan parent education/involvement activities
